Mission
Promote, perserve and commemorate maritime history. Educate members in maritime history, in particular, naval events via email, on-line classes, and meetings. Encourage junior and high school students to research and present maritime history. Recognize and award maritime related leadership, current and historical. Promote a community of like minded individuals to share maritime related personal experiences.
Programs
3 programs
Education of NOUS companions and the general public of significant maritime historical events from Revolutionary, 1812, Civil, WWI, WWII, Vietnam to Iraq wars. Major search, rescue and seizures guarding US coastal waters.
Education of companions via email, newsletters, Zoom and in person meetings on historical maritime events.
Recognition and presentation of non-monitary awards and plaques for outstanding examples of leadership by active and retired military leaders of the Navy, Marines, Coast Guard and civilians in performance of their jobs supporting maritime services and the NOUS organization
